Understanding Musk’s Political Shift
Elon Musk has never been shy about his opinions. From tweeting market-shaking comments about Bitcoin and Dogecoin to challenging narratives on free speech via his acquisition of X (formerly Twitter), Musk’s political inclinations have increasingly leaned toward disruption. Recently, headlines suggesting Musk’s intention to create a new political movement raise important questions. Is this a genuine political stance or a strategic maneuver to influence policy and public opinion in tech and crypto regulation?

Implications for Crypto Investors
For crypto investors, rumors around Elon Musk’s political motivations hold more weight than mere gossip. Musk’s historical influence on the digital asset market is well-documented — a single tweet from him has been known to send coin prices soaring or crashing. If he establishes a political platform, it’s likely such a movement would be tech- and crypto-friendly, promoting decentralization, financial innovation, and less regulatory interference. This could create a favorable policy environment — though, as always, volatility remains a key consideration.
